.version.lernwerkstatt /* version checker */
{
	color: #0000F0;
	background-color: #D4B79B;
}

.html
{
	background-color: #313C99;
	background: -webkit-gradient(linear, center top, center bottom, from(#313C99),color-stop(100%, #07A1E2));
	background: -webkit-linear-gradient(top,#313C99 ,#07A1E2 100%);
	background: linear-gradient(to bottom,#313C99 ,#07A1E2 100%);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r=#FF313C99, endColorstr=#FF07A1E2, GradientType=0);
	-ms-filter: "progid:DXImageTransform.Microsoft.gradient(startColorstr='#FF313C99', endColorstr='#FF07A1E2', GradientType=0)";
}

#page
{
	z-index: 1;
	width: 1024px;
	min-height: 780px;
	background-image: none;
	border-style: none;
	border-color: transparent;
	background-color: transparent;
	padding-bottom: 14px;
	margin-left: auto;
	margin-right: auto;
}

#u16241
{
	z-index: 2;
	width: 1224px;
	background-color: transparent;
	opacity: 0.03;
	-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=3)";
	filter: alpha(opacity=3);
	position: relative;
	margin-right: -10000px;
	margin-top: -30px;
	left: -100px;
}

#u16241_clip
{
	overflow: hidden;
	width: 1224px;
	height: 754px;
}

#u16241_img
{
	margin-top: -164px;
}

#u16244
{
	z-index: 4;
	width: 655px;
	border-style: none;
	border-color: transparent;
	background-color: #B6E9FF;
	border-radius: 5px;
	position: relative;
	margin-right: -10000px;
	margin-top: 143px;
	left: 278px;
	padding: 11px 16px 8px 39px;
}

#pu16306-22
{
	width: 0.01px;
}

#u16306-22
{
	z-index: 48;
	width: 430px;
	min-height: 496px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	margin-top: 21px;
}

#u16306-5,#u16306-7
{
	letter-spacing: 1px;
}

#u19233
{
	z-index: 107;
	width: 200px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	left: 455px;
}

#u19233_clip
{
	overflow: hidden;
	width: 200px;
	height: 97px;
}

#u19233_img
{
	margin-right: -11px;
	margin-bottom: -4px;
}

#u16352
{
	z-index: 100;
	width: 430px;
	background-color: #FFFFFF;
	margin-top: 18px;
	position: relative;
}

#u16387-4
{
	z-index: 102;
	width: 430px;
	min-height: 53px;
	background-color: transparent;
	margin-top: 13px;
	position: relative;
}

#menuu16245
{
	z-index: 5;
	width: 214px;
	border-style: none;
	border-color: transparent;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	margin-top: 145px;
	left: 26px;
}

#u16274
{
	width: 214px;
	background-color: transparent;
	position: relative;
}

#u16277
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16280
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-bottom: -2px;
	margin-right: -10000px;
	top: -1px;
	background: url("../images/u16280.png") no-repeat 0px 0px;
}

#u16277:hover #u16280
{
	background: url("../images/u16280-r.png") no-repeat 0px 0px;
}

#u16277.MuseMenuActive #u16280
{
	background: url("../images/u16280-a.png") no-repeat 0px 0px;
}

#u16300
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16302
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-bottom: -2px;
	margin-right: -10000px;
	top: -1px;
	background: url("../images/u16302.png") no-repeat 0px 0px;
}

#u16300:hover #u16302
{
	background: url("../images/u16302-r.png") no-repeat 0px 0px;
}

#u16300.MuseMenuActive #u16302
{
	background: url("../images/u16302-a.png") no-repeat 0px 0px;
}

#u16261
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16262
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-bottom: -2px;
	margin-right: -10000px;
	top: -1px;
	background: url("../images/u16262.png") no-repeat 0px 0px;
}

#u16261:hover #u16262
{
	background: url("../images/u16262-r.png") no-repeat 0px 0px;
}

#u16261.MuseMenuActive #u16262
{
	background: url("../images/u16262-a.png") no-repeat 0px 0px;
}

#u16282
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16285
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-bottom: -2px;
	margin-right: -10000px;
	top: -1px;
	background: url("../images/u16285.png") no-repeat 0px 0px;
}

#u16282:hover #u16285
{
	background: url("../images/u16285-r.png") no-repeat 0px 0px;
}

#u16282.MuseMenuActive #u16285
{
	background: url("../images/u16285-a.png") no-repeat 0px 0px;
}

#u16254
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16256
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-bottom: -2px;
	margin-right: -10000px;
	top: -1px;
	background: url("../images/u16256.png") no-repeat 0px 0px;
}

#u16254:hover #u16256
{
	background: url("../images/u16256-r.png") no-repeat 0px 0px;
}

#u16254.MuseMenuActive #u16256
{
	background: url("../images/u16256-a.png") no-repeat 0px 0px;
}

#u16247
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16249
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-right: -10000px;
	background: url("../images/u16249.png") no-repeat 0px 0px;
}

#u16247:hover #u16249
{
	background: url("../images/u16249-r.png") no-repeat 0px 0px;
}

#u16247.MuseMenuActive #u16249
{
	background: url("../images/u16249-a.png") no-repeat 0px 0px;
}

#u16299,#u16260,#u16281,#u16253,#u16246,#u16267
{
	width: 214px;
	background-color: transparent;
	margin-top: 2px;
	position: relative;
}

#u16268
{
	width: 214px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
}

#u16277:hover,#u16300:hover,#u16261:hover,#u16282:hover,#u16254:hover,#u16247:hover,#u16268:hover
{
	width: 214px;
	min-height: 0px;
	margin: 0px -10000px 0px 0px;
}

#u16270
{
	height: 30px;
	width: 214px;
	vertical-align: top;
	position: relative;
	margin-right: -10000px;
	background: url("../images/u16270.png") no-repeat 0px 0px;
}

#u16268:hover #u16270
{
	background: url("../images/u16270-r.png") no-repeat 0px 0px;
}

#u16268.MuseMenuActive #u16270
{
	background: url("../images/u16270-a.png") no-repeat 0px 0px;
}

.MenuItem /* unifiedNavBar */
{
	cursor: pointer;
}

#u16307-26
{
	z-index: 70;
	width: 150px;
	min-height: 176px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	margin-top: 486px;
	left: 37px;
}

#u16307-17
{
	font-size: 12px;
	padding-bottom: 5px;
}

#u16307-13,#u16307-22
{
	line-height: 0px;/* 0 for mixed font sized paras; applied on spans instead */
}

#u16307-13  span,#u16307-13  a,#u16307-22  span,#u16307-22  a /* line-height set on spans of mixed font sized paras */
{
	line-height: 1.31;
}

#u16307-2,#u16307-4,#u16307-6,#u16307-8,#u16307-10,#u16307-11,#u16307-14,#u16307-15,#u16307-19,#u16307-20,#u16307-24
{
	font-size: 12px;
}

#u16308
{
	z-index: 96;
	width: 125px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	margin-top: 450px;
	left: 36px;
}

#u16310
{
	z-index: 98;
	width: 502px;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	left: 37px;
}

#u17368
{
	z-index: 106;
	width: 50px;
	min-height: 50px;
	border-style: none;
	border-color: transparent;
	background-color: transparent;
	position: relative;
	margin-right: -10000px;
	margin-top: 760px;
	left: 37px;
}

body
{
	position: relative;
	min-width: 1024px;
	padding-top: 30px;
	padding-bottom: 42px;
}

#page .verticalspacer
{
	clear: both;
}

